Leadership Review Briefing — Pricing of the Ardell Line

The Ardell instrument line is priced 8–12% below comparable offerings, eroding margin despite strong volume. Analysis by the Westholt pricing group supports a staged increase across three tiers, with grandfathering for contracts signed before March. Department heads should review the attached elasticity estimates carefully. The proposed timing and its dependencies are detailed in the confidential note below.

management briefing: Istaelix Group is in early talks to buy Sorysax Logistics for about $496.2 million. The Kasox launch date is October 3, and nothing goes to the press before then. Legal wants the Norokax Foods term sheet withdrawn before April 25.

Good evening all — a note from the front desk ahead of the weekend. Both passenger lifts in the Corvane Building will be out of service from Saturday 06:00 until Sunday evening for scheduled maintenance. The goods lift remains available but must be operated in attendant mode, and the contractors will be on site throughout. Please log any lift-related calls in the night book rather than phoning through. To unlock the goods lift control panel, enter the override code below.

door code, yagap-bahof: bdg-O-05

Hi Mirela,

Quick handover on the RackRunner pick-list optimizer. One open item: the Osterfeld warehouse is seeing slow route generation during the morning batch — I bumped the solver timeout as a stopgap, ticket is open. For new folks: runbooks are in the team wiki under RackRunner/oncall, and alerts page through the usual channel. Anything confusing during your shift, send questions to the address below.

escalation mailbox, yafog-kafof: eliok@xolmarcloud.local